SINGLE TO DIFFERENTIAL ADC DRIVER
convert a single analog signal into an ADC with differential inputs.
Some ADC's require an op amp to provide the appropriate gain and
offset to match the signal to the input range of the ADC. An ADC may
generate transient currents at their input due to the internal conver-
sion circuit, and these currents need to be isolated from the signal
source. The circuit in Figure 1 will provide a low impedance drive and
absorb these currents. The first op amp offsets the input signal 1.25V
while operating in unity gain. The output of the first op amp goes into
the IN+ of the ADC and the inverting input of the second op amp. The
second op amp inverts the signal around the 1.25VDC level applied to
its non-inverting input and the output is connected to the IN- of the
ADC. Optional filtering can be added to reduce high frequency noise
from the ADC inputs if required.
